Hindu devotees bring large idols of the elephant-headed Hindu god Ganesha to immerse them in the Arabian Sea, on the final day of the festival of Ganesh Chaturthi in Mumbai, on September 8, 2014. Every year millions of devout Hindus immerse the idols into oceans and rivers during the ten-day long Ganesh Chaturthi festival that celebrates the birth of Ganesha. (Photo by Rafiq Maqbool/AP Photo)

Devotees splash water on an idol of Hindu elephant god Ganesh, the deity of prosperity, as it is carried for immersion into the Arabian Sea on the last day of the Ganesh Chaturthi festival in Mumbai September 8, 2014. Ganesh idols are taken through the streets in a procession accompanied by dancing and singing, and later immersed in a river or the sea, symbolising a ritual seeing-off of his journey towards his abode, taking away with him the misfortunes of all mankind. (Photo by Bernat Armangue/AP Photo)

An environmental activist confronts a riot policeman securing a construction site in the Sivens forest, as clearing has started in preparation of the Sivens dam construction, on September 9, 2014 near Gaillac, in the Tarn region. Although the construction of the dam would help supply water to nearby farms, it would remove a 13 hectares long reservoir of biodiversity. Proponents of the dam – including the FDSEA (Departemental Federation of syndicated farmers) – deemed necessary to secure water supplies for farmers. Opponents – backed by French Europe Ecologie Les Verts (EELV) green party member of the European Parliament – are moved by the disappearance of a wetland sheltering 94 protected species and therefore denounce the projected irrigated agricultural model. (Photo by Remy Gabalda/AFP Photo)

Young ragpickers collect clothes, coins, wooden materials and other usable items cluttered at the bank of the Jawahar Lal Nehru lake after the immersion of Lord Ganesh idols to mark the end of the Ganesh festival, in Bhopal, India, September 9, 2014. Despite of the warning of the district administration not to immerse idols in the lake to protect the environment, hundreds of idols have been immersed by devotees, resulting in a huge pollution of the lakes in India. (Photo by Sanheev Gupta/EPA)
